Tom Rini 83d290c56f SPDX: Convert all of our single license tags to Linux Kernel style
When U-Boot started using SPDX tags we were among the early adopters and
there weren't a lot of other examples to borrow from.  So we picked the
area of the file that usually had a full license text and replaced it
with an appropriate SPDX-License-Identifier: entry.  Since then, the
Linux Kernel has adopted SPDX tags and they place it as the very first
line in a file (except where shebangs are used, then it's second line)
and with slightly different comment styles than us.

In part due to community overlap, in part due to better tag visibility
and in part for other minor reasons, switch over to that style.

This commit changes all instances where we have a single declared
license in the tag as both the before and after are identical in tag
contents.  There's also a few places where I found we did not have a tag
and have introduced one.

// S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0+
/*
* Copyright (c) 2017 Theobroma Systems Design und Consulting GmbH
*/
#include <common.h>
#include <clk.h>
#include <display.h>
#include <dm.h>
#include <dw_hdmi.h>
#include <edid.h>
#include <regmap.h>
#include <syscon.h>
#include <asm/gpio.h>
#include <asm/io.h>
#include <asm/arch/clock.h>
#include <asm/arch/hardware.h>
#include <asm/arch/grf_rk3288.h>
#include <power/regulator.h>
#include "rk_hdmi.h"
static int rk3288_hdmi_enable(struct udevice *dev, int panel_bpp,
const struct display_timing *edid)
{
struct rk_hdmi_priv *priv = dev_get_priv(dev);
struct display_plat *uc_plat = dev_get_uclass_platdata(dev);
int vop_id = uc_plat->source_id;
struct rk3288_grf *grf = priv->grf;
/* hdmi source select hdmi controller */
rk_setreg(&grf->soc_con6, 1 << 15);
/* hdmi data from vop id */
rk_clrsetreg(&grf->soc_con6, 1 << 4, (vop_id == 1) ? (1 << 4) : 0);
return 0;
}
static int rk3288_hdmi_ofdata_to_platdata(struct udevice *dev)
{
struct rk_hdmi_priv *priv = dev_get_priv(dev);
struct dw_hdmi *hdmi = &priv->hdmi;
hdmi->i2c_clk_high = 0x7a;
hdmi->i2c_clk_low = 0x8d;
/*
* TODO(sjg@chromium.org): The above values don't work - these
* ones work better, but generate lots of errors in the data.
*/
hdmi->i2c_clk_high = 0x0d;
hdmi->i2c_clk_low = 0x0d;
return rk_hdmi_ofdata_to_platdata(dev);
}
static int rk3288_clk_config(struct udevice *dev)
{
struct display_plat *uc_plat = dev_get_uclass_platdata(dev);
struct clk clk;
int ret;
/*
* Configure the maximum clock to permit whatever resolution the
* monitor wants
*/
ret = clk_get_by_index(uc_plat->src_dev, 0, &clk);
if (ret >= 0) {
ret = clk_set_rate(&clk, 384000000);
clk_free(&clk);
}
if (ret < 0) {
debug("%s: Failed to set clock in source device '%s': ret=%d\n",
__func__, uc_plat->src_dev->name, ret);
return ret;
}
return 0;
}
static const char * const rk3288_regulator_names[] = {
"vcc50_hdmi"
};
static int rk3288_hdmi_probe(struct udevice *dev)
{
/* Enable VOP clock for RK3288 */
rk3288_clk_config(dev);
/* Enable regulators required for HDMI */
rk_hdmi_probe_regulators(dev, rk3288_regulator_names,
ARRAY_SIZE(rk3288_regulator_names));
return rk_hdmi_probe(dev);
}
static const struct dm_display_ops rk3288_hdmi_ops = {
.read_edid = rk_hdmi_read_edid,
.enable = rk3288_hdmi_enable,
};
static const struct udevice_id rk3288_hdmi_ids[] = {
{ .compatible = "rockchip,rk3288-dw-hdmi" },
{ }
};
U_BOOT_DRIVER(rk3288_hdmi_rockchip) = {
.name = "rk3288_hdmi_rockchip",
.id = UCLASS_DISPLAY,
.of_match = rk3288_hdmi_ids,
.ops = &rk3288_hdmi_ops,
.ofdata_to_platdata = rk3288_hdmi_ofdata_to_platdata,
.probe = rk3288_hdmi_probe,
.priv_auto_alloc_size = sizeof(struct rk_hdmi_priv),
};
